Вы можете выбрать объект в существующем потоке данных. Существует два способа создания встроенного потока данных.
Опция 1
Щелкните правой кнопкой мыши по объекту и выберите, чтобы сделать его встроенным потоком данных.
Вариант 2
Перетащите полный и проверенный поток данных из библиотеки объектов в открытый поток данных в рабочей области. Далее откройте созданный поток данных. Выберите объект, который вы хотите использовать в качестве порта ввода и вывода, и нажмите make port для этого объекта.
Службы данных добавляют этот объект в качестве точки подключения для встроенного потока данных.
Переменные и параметры
Вы можете использовать локальные и глобальные переменные с потоком данных и рабочим потоком, что обеспечивает большую гибкость при проектировании заданий.
Ключевые особенности —
-
Тип данных переменной может быть числом, целым числом, десятичным числом, датой или текстовой строкой, подобной символу.
-
Переменные могут использоваться в потоках данных и рабочих потоках как функция в предложении Where .
-
Локальные переменные в службах данных ограничены объектом, в котором они созданы.
-
Глобальные переменные ограничены заданиями, в которых они созданы. Используя глобальные переменные, вы можете изменить значения глобальных переменных по умолчанию во время выполнения.
-
Выражения, которые используются в рабочем процессе и потоке данных, называются параметрами .
-
Все переменные и параметры в рабочем потоке и потоках данных отображаются в окне переменных и параметров.
Тип данных переменной может быть числом, целым числом, десятичным числом, датой или текстовой строкой, подобной символу.
Переменные могут использоваться в потоках данных и рабочих потоках как функция в предложении Where .
Локальные переменные в службах данных ограничены объектом, в котором они созданы.
Глобальные переменные ограничены заданиями, в которых они созданы. Используя глобальные переменные, вы можете изменить значения глобальных переменных по умолчанию во время выполнения.
Выражения, которые используются в рабочем процессе и потоке данных, называются параметрами .
Все переменные и параметры в рабочем потоке и потоках данных отображаются в окне переменных и параметров.
Чтобы просмотреть переменные и параметры, выполните следующие действия:
Перейдите в Инструменты → Переменные.
Новое окно Переменные и параметры отображается. Он имеет две вкладки — Определения и Звонки.
Вкладка « Определения » позволяет создавать и просматривать переменные и параметры. Вы можете использовать локальные переменные и параметры на рабочем потоке и уровне потока данных. Глобальные переменные могут использоваться на уровне работы.
работа |
Локальные переменные Глобальные переменные |
Сценарий или условный в работе Любой объект в работе |
Рабочий процесс |
Локальные переменные параметры |
Этот рабочий поток или передается другим рабочим потокам или потокам данных с помощью параметра. Родительские объекты для передачи локальных переменных. Рабочие процессы могут также возвращать переменные или параметры родительским объектам. |
Поток данных |
параметры |
Предложение WHERE, сопоставление столбцов или функция в потоке данных. Поток данных. Потоки данных не могут возвращать выходные значения. |
работа
Локальные переменные
Глобальные переменные
Сценарий или условный в работе
Любой объект в работе
Рабочий процесс
Локальные переменные
параметры
Этот рабочий поток или передается другим рабочим потокам или потокам данных с помощью параметра.
Родительские объекты для передачи локальных переменных. Рабочие процессы могут также возвращать переменные или параметры родительским объектам.
Поток данных
параметры
Предложение WHERE, сопоставление столбцов или функция в потоке данных. Поток данных. Потоки данных не могут возвращать выходные значения.
На вкладке вызова вы можете увидеть имя параметра, определенного для всех объектов в определении родительского объекта.
Определение локальной переменной
Чтобы определить локальную переменную, откройте работу в реальном времени.
Шаг 1 — Перейдите в Инструменты → Переменные. Откроется новое окно переменных и параметров .
Шаг 2 — Перейдите в Переменную → Щелкните правой кнопкой мыши → Вставить
Это создаст новый параметр $ NewVariable0 .
Шаг 3 — Введите имя новой переменной. Выберите тип данных из списка.
Как только это определено, закройте окно. Аналогичным образом вы можете определить параметры для потока данных и рабочего потока.